Molecular Ensemble Research
This interdisciplinary research project is aiming to understand exquisite behaviors of the biological systems and molecular-based materials (conductors, magnets, ...etc.) in terms of the non-covalent interactions and their changes at atomic and molecular levels.
Super Analyzer Development Technology Research
Using unique processing technologies developed in RIKEN, the research group promotes an establishment of fabrication technologies for creating key parts and infrastructure technology development.
Study on Genesis of Matter (Phase II)
The origin of matter in universe as well as elements on the earth is one of major subjects in pure physics, and the knowledge obtained leads to intellectual properties for general public.
JEM-EUSO Mission to Explore Extreme Energy Universe
One of outstanding features of the Universe is spontaneous evolutions toward extreme conditions, including the formation of black holes from normal stars, and the production of extremely energetic cosmic rays.
Lipid Dynamics
Lipids are emerging as the last target of post-genome era. Accumulating evidence indicates the importance of lipids in most of the biological phenomena. However, their study has been hampered by the lack of appropriate techniques.
Cellular Systems Biology
The cell is a fundamental unit of life. The goal of our research project is to understand the architecture, dynamics and information processing of the cell as a whole system. Toward this ambitious goal, we combine multidisciplinary approaches.
